The Role of AI and Machine Learning in SEO
Search engines are better able to comprehend user behavior, content, and search intent thanks to AI and ML. Google's AI-powered algorithms, such RankBrain and BERT, examine web pages and search queries in a manner that closely resembles human thought processes. These technologies impact a webpage's ranking by determining how relevant it is to a user's search.
For instance, RankBrain deciphers complicated or confusing search terms and returns the most pertinent results. BERT helps Google comprehend the context of words in a query by concentrating on natural language processing (NLP). Traditional keyword stuffing is no longer effective in light of these developments. Rather, content needs to be educational, organized, and in line with user goal.
How AI Affects Local SEO in New Hampshire
AI significantly affects local search rankings for New Hampshire businesses. AI is used by Google's Local Search algorithms to identify companies that best fit a user's search query. A number of factors are important, including social media signals, website activity, and online reviews.
Optimizing Google My Business (GMB) has never been more crucial. In order to deliver the most pertinent local search results, AI analyses GMB listings. Companies with thorough and accurate listings, excellent photos, and favorable reviews are more likely to rank higher.
Voice search, powered by AI, is also influencing local SEO. More people are using smart assistants like Siri and Google Assistant to search for local businesses. These searches tend to be more conversational, so businesses should optimize for long-tail keywords and natural language queries.

The Impact of AI on Technical SEO
Technical SEO is impacted by AI-driven SEO in addition to content and keywords. Websites that load rapidly, offer a smooth user experience, and are responsive are given preference by search engines.
Businesses can analyze technical SEO difficulties and offer recommendations with the aid of AI tools. Businesses can effectively optimize their websites with features like predictive analytics, AI-driven keyword analysis, and automatic site audits.
Aspects like Core Web Vitals, which gauge page performance, interaction, and visual stability, are also taken into account by Google's AI algorithms. Better rankings are given to websites that adhere to these guidelines. To be competitive, New Hampshire businesses need to make sure their websites are optimized for these technological factors.

AI and Voice Search Optimization
AI is essential to the accuracy and efficacy of voice search, which is still expanding. Artificial intelligence (AI)-driven algorithms understand user intent when they utilize voice commands to search and provide pertinent results.
New Hampshire businesses need to use question-based keywords and natural language phrases to optimize for voice search. The likelihood of content showing up in voice search results is increased by employing schema markup for highlighted snippets and conversational content structure.
Voice search also requires mobile optimization. Websites need to be mobile-friendly, quick to load, and simple to use because the majority of voice searches take place on mobile devices.
